 Report about the activity of Babil Center

 Babil Center was opened on 15/2/2006 where the door of registration in the course announced by the center was opened and they I the course of teaching computer, the course of teaching tailoring and sewing, the courses of teaching English language and the course of eradication of illiteracy) After completion of the appropriate numbers to hold the courses we notice that there is good interest in the courses of computer, English language and sewing and we noticed weak interest in the courses of eradication of illiteracy, therefore we started working in the course of computer English language and saving and participations were registered since opening the door of registration and their numbers was large enough to held courses in the three fielding (computer, sewing, English language). The first group was received and according to the numbers of each course and informing the other registered with the date of holding the second course and taking the contacting them in order  to inform them of the dates of holding the course.

Thus three courses were holed in each of (computer teaching, English language teaching, dialogue and grammar), sewing teaching) during the [period from 1/3/2006 up to 22/6/2006.

 And below is table explaining the number of participants in each of the three courses in the field of (Computer, English Language, and Sewing):

 As for what courses education in democracy and human rights:

 The first lectures was allocated for education and the role of civil society organizations in spreading the cultural of human rights and establishing democracy, and a time was allocated for discussion between the trainees and the lectures, and there was also weakly seminars for educating in democracy and human rights there were also lectures concerning the Iraqi constitution and explaining the chapter of rights and freedoms and linking them the principles of human rights and what is included in the two international conventions pertaining the civil and political rights and the social, economical and cultural rights. And in order to increase the information and encouraging the trainees to read, an educational booklet was distributed talking about rights and freedoms in the constitution titled (1 and the constitution).

And during the period from 28- 30/6/2006 the coder of the center participated in the first seminar about democracy and human rights which was held in Baghdad.  

 Evaluation of the Project

 The project was very good from the aspect of the aim and the subjects thought in it through the courses of computers, sewing and English language and through the other educational subjects about democracy and human rights, where we noticed that there is continued increase by participating to participate in the course of the center.

 We also noticed the inhabitants of the district come at the end of each cover and they deliver a speech praising the activity of the center and the services it provides participating in educating and developing people, men and women and this in true participate in building democratic Iraqi, and this indicates the success of the work of the center. 

 The center provides all the services and facilities which will achieve the aim of the project and increase the ability, development and education of members of our society of children, women, men and youth. It is worth mentioning that the center targets participants of various sectors of society especially the poor of them.

And we notice that during the three course held in the center (140) participate were trounced and educated, representing women, youth and children and as shown below in the table.

 d from the table above we noticed that the project targets the women, youth and children and we believe that targeting these sectors is very important in our society therefore e believe that the project is continuing in achieving its aims in training and education.

As for what concerns the other technical matters, our organization has endeavored to provide all the requirements of holding the courses of (computers, sewing and eradication of illiteracy, and education in democracy and human rights) of stationery, computer devices, sewing machines, paper lectures, CDs for lectures and usual aids, and the atmosphere is appropriate to held courses, also covering the charges of transportation of participants in each course and this is fixed in the financial reports.

And the center is continuing is holding training courses according to the new plan.
